Metal Soaps - Essential Additives

Metal soaps are among the most effective stabilizers used in the plastics industry, renowned for their excellent stabilizing and lubricating properties. These versatile compounds also serve critical roles as acid scavengers and mould release agents, enhancing the overall performance of plastic formulations.

 

Esters - Key Lubricants

Ester lubricants are indispensable additives in the plastics sector. Their performance and characteristics are influenced by the balance of functional groups and non-polar components, which are crucial for optimizing their effectiveness in various applications.

Application areas

PVC

Despite processing challenges, PVC (Polyvinylchloride) is one of the most widely used plastics. To ensure efficient PVC processing, the use of various additives is essential, including stabilizers, preblends, and lubricants.

Metal soaps are highly effective stabilizers for PVC, providing excellent lubrication properties as well. Our extensive product portfolio features calcium and zinc stearates. Additionally, we offer customized metal soap preblends tailored to meet specific processing requirements.

While metal soaps provide notable lubrication, esters are often required as supplementary lubricants. Our comprehensive range of ester products provides solutions for both internal and external lubrication, enhancing the overall performance of PVC formulations.

Polyolefins

Polyolefins encompasses polypropylene (PP) and polyethylene (PE), two of the most widely used and recognized plastics. Unlike PVC, polyolefins are significantly easier to process, making them a preferred choice in various applications.

Metal soaps are essential additives for polyolefins, with calcium stearate and zinc stearate being the most commonly used products. These additives serve primarily as acid scavengers, preventing corrosion of processing tools caused by acids generated during manufacturing. Additionally, they provide a beneficial lubricating effect

Our comprehensive product portfolio is designed to meet specific application requirements, ensuring excellent filter test results and optimal performance.

While esters are not always needed as lubricants in polyolefin applications, they can offer additional advantages, enhancing the overall processing efficiency.

SMC / BMC

SMC (Sheet Moulding Compound) and BMC (Bulk Moulding Compound) are advanced fiber-reinforced plastics known for their superior resilience compared to PVC and polyolefins. This enhanced durability makes them ideal for a variety of applications.

Metal soaps are essential additives used as mould release agents. They facilitate easy separation of the plastic mass from the mould without compromising surface quality. The most commonly used metal soaps are calcium and zinc stearates, with zinc stearate often preferred for its lower melting point.

Engineering Plastics

Engineering plastics are distinguished from standard plastics by their superior mechanical and thermal properties, as well as enhanced chemical stability. This category encompasses a variety of plastic types tailored for specific applications.

Metal soaps and ester lubricants plays a crucial role in the production of engineering plastics. The choice of products depends on the specific type of plastic being processed.
